Orchid Class 102 is the continuum to Orchid Class 101. In this class you will learn more advanced material and information on the more difficult Orchids to grow. We do recommend that you take Orchid Class 101 first, as that will allow you to obtain the basic care information before embarking on the more challenging species. The class will be conducted in the same format as the first class. It will be held One Thursday evening at the beginning of each quarter so you can find the dates for these classes in January, April, July, and October on our calendar page. David Bird will be your instructor for this particular class and will take you to the more in-depth stages of Orchid culture. Similar to how you were asked to re pot a non-blooming Moth Orchid in Orchid Class 101, in Orchid Class 102 you will get the opportunity to mount a Orchid onto a piece of cork and create your own ‘Cork Orchid’ to take home at the end of the evening.
